▸ adjective: Strong in growth; growing with vigour or rapidity, hence, coarse or gross.
▸ adjective: Causing strong growth; producing luxuriantly; rich and fertile.
▸ adjective: Suffering from overgrowth or hypertrophy; plethoric.
▸ adjective: Strong to the senses; offensive; noisome.
▸ adjective: Having a very strong and bad taste or odor.
▸ adjective: (informal) Gross, disgusting, foul.
▸ adjective: (intensifier, negative) complete, unmitigated, utter.
▸ adjective: (obsolete) lustful; lascivious
▸ adverb: (obsolete) Quickly, eagerly, impetuously.
▸ noun: A row of people or things organized in a grid pattern, often soldiers.
▸ noun: (chess) One of the eight horizontal lines of squares on a chessboard (i.e., those identified by a number).
▸ noun: (music) In a pipe organ, a set of pipes of a certain quality for which each pipe corresponds to one key or pedal.
▸ noun: One's position in a list sorted by a shared property such as physical location, population, or quality.
▸ noun: The level of one's position in a class-based society.
▸ noun: (typically in the plural) A category of people, such as those who share an occupation or belong to an organisation.
▸ noun: A hierarchical level in an organization such as the military.
▸ noun: (taxonomy) A level in a scientific taxonomy system.
▸ noun: (mathematics) The dimensionality of an array (computing) or tensor.
▸ noun: (linear algebra) The maximal number of linearly independent columns (or rows) of a matrix.
▸ noun: (algebra) The maximum quantity of D-linearly independent elements of a module (over an integral domain D).
▸ noun: (mathematics) The size of any basis of a given matroid.
▸ verb: To place abreast, or in a line.
▸ verb: To have a ranking.
▸ verb: To assign a suitable place in a class or order; to classify.
▸ verb: (US) To take rank of; to outrank.
▸ noun: A surname.
